Display Device Opening Moisture Barrier via Segmented Metal Stack

Resolve Bottlenecks,
Find Innovative Solutions
Generate Solutions

Solution Overview

Problem

Display devices with openings are susceptible to moisture penetration, which can damage surrounding display elements.

Innovation Solution

A display device with a substrate having an opening, featuring a metal stacked structure comprising a first sub-metal layer with a first hole and a second sub-metal layer with a second hole, where the second hole overlaps the first hole and has a greater width, and an intermediate layer including organic material layers separated by the metal structure.

A display device includes: a substrate having an opening; a plurality of display elements at a display area adjacent to the opening, the plurality of display elements each including a pixel electrode, an opposite electrode, and an intermediate layer between the pixel electrode and the opposite electrode; and a metal stacked structure between the opening and the display area, and including: a first sub-metal layer having a first hole; and a second sub-metal layer under the first sub-metal layer and having a second hole, the second hole overlapping with the first hole and having a width greater than a width of the first hole.
